Why does Intel® Stratix® 10 FPGA Remote System Upgrade reconfiguration sometimes fail when driving nCONFIG?
Description
Remote System Upgrade reconfigurations may sometimes fail and requires a power cycle of the Intel® Stratix 10 FPGA to recover the configuration. This problem may be seen at a low probability while reconfiguration is repeated when driving nCONFIG.
This problem applies to either the Active Serial Configuration modes or Avalon® streaming configuration modes.
Resolution
This problem is fixed starting with the Intel® Quartus® Prime Pro Edition Software v20.3.
To resolve this problem, download and install the latest device manager firmware for the Intel® Quartus® Prime Pro Edition Software 21.1/21.2/21.3/21.4/22.1/22.2/22.3.
